Road Block and Closure on KL roads: Bersih 3.0 (April 28 2012)

*


It is likely that there will be road blocks & closures in KL this Saturday (28th April) due to the coming Bersih 3.0 rally.

There are no confirmed roads yet, but it is certain that roads surrounding Dataran Merdeka (which has already been cordoned off) are likely to be affected. Based on speculation on the internet, we believe that the list of roads below will be encountering road blocks (effective Friday, 2012-04-27 @ 1800hrs):

1. After Jalan Duta Toll (KL bound – Opposite the new Palace);
2. Jalan Parlimen (Leading… to the Lake Gardens);
3. In front of the old Palace (Both directions);
4. After the Sg. Besi Toll leading to KL;
5. Jalan Tun Razak (3 locations)
6. Cheras junction leading into the city;
7. Opposite the American Embassy;
8. Jalan Ampang;
9. City centre – opposite bangunan Daya Bumi;
10. Jalan Ipoh – opposite the old Sentul IPD (District Police Headquarters)

If you get any information about road blocks or closures, please feel free to share it on this forum so that other road users can be up-to-date in avoiding motoring hell.

Just to quickly update the latest that we've heard:

1. JALAN KEPONG (IN FRONT OF THE POLICE STATION)
2. SELAYANG (NEAR THE NEW WARTA SUPERMARKET)
3. NKVE - PLUS HIGHWAY (BETWEEN PUTRA HEIGHTS TO SUBANG INTERCHANGES)
4. SEREMBAN HIGHWAY NEAR DESA PETALING 9NEAR THE HUGE FURNITURE SHOP)
5. JALAN IPOH (NEAR TEMPLER'S PARK & 5TH MILE)
6. JALAN KUCHING (AFTER SEGAMBUT ROUNDABOUT)
7. JALAN AMPANG (NEAR GREAT EASTERN MALL)
8. FEDERAL HIGHWAY (NEAR VOLVO)
9. OLD KLANG ROAD (NEAR THE PETALING POLICE STATION)
10. INTERSECTION ROAD NEAR LAKE GARDEN
11. JALAN DAMANSARA (NEAR UN BUILDING)

To those who might be using those roads, please plan your journey ahead and be wary.
